What factors determine 6V golf cart battery lifespan?

Chemistry, plate design, and usage patterns critically impact longevity. Flooded lead-acid batteries degrade faster due to sulfation if discharged below 50%, while lithium-ion cells withstand 80% DoD. Thicker plates (5–6mm) in premium lead-acid models like Trojan T-105 reduce corrosion. Pro Tip: Store carts at full charge—lead-acid loses 1% capacity daily when idle. Imagine two 6V batteries: one used daily for 18 holes loses 30% capacity yearly; another used weekly lasts 2x longer. Always check water levels monthly—low electrolyte exposes plates, causing irreversible damage.

⚠️ Critical: Never mix old and new lead-acid batteries—weakest cell drags down the entire pack, accelerating failure.

Flooded vs. AGM vs. Lithium: Which 6V type lasts longest?

Lithium-ion (2,000–5,000 cycles) outlasts AGM (600 cycles) and flooded (500–800 cycles). AGM batteries eliminate watering but suffer from higher $/cycle costs versus flooded. Lithium’s 95% efficiency reduces charging time—3 hours vs. 8+ for lead-acid. Pro Tip: For cold climates, AGM handles -20°C better than flooded. A 6V 230Ah lithium pack weighs 70 lbs versus 130 lbs for lead-acid, reducing cart strain. Why pay more upfront? Lithium’s 10-year lifespan often offsets 3x higher initial cost through reduced replacements.

How to extend 6V battery lifespan?

Use temperature-compensated charging (-4mV/°C/cell for lead-acid) and avoid deep discharges. Equalize flooded batteries monthly at 7.4V for 2 hours to combat stratification. For lithium, keep cells between -10°C and 45°C during charging. Pro Tip: Clean terminals quarterly—corrosion adds 0.2Ω resistance, wasting 5% energy. Picture a battery post coated in baking soda paste—it neutralizes acid while scrubbing away oxidation. Why risk water contamination? Use distilled water only—impurities accelerate plate decay.

Do charging practices affect 6V battery longevity?

Absolutely—overcharging boils electrolyte in flooded batteries, while undercharging causes sulfation. Smart chargers with float modes (13.8V for lithium) prevent voltage spikes. Pro Tip: Charge after every use—partial cycles stress lead-acid more than full ones. Imagine a 6V battery charged to 90% daily—it’ll fail 30% faster than one fully recharged. Ever heard of “memory effect”? It’s a myth for lead-acid, but lithium benefits from occasional full discharges for calibration.

FAQs

Are lithium 6V batteries worth the higher cost?

Yes for heavy users—10+ year lifespans and 80% DoD tolerance justify upfront costs through 5x fewer replacements versus lead-acid.

Can I mix 6V battery brands in my cart?

Never—variations in internal resistance cause imbalance. Mismatched brands lose 15–20% capacity within 6 months.
